PeoplePC Selected by Cinergy Corp. to Offer Employees Affordable Home Computer and Internet Access

3/27/2001 8:46:00 AM

SAN FRANCISCO--(BUSINESS WIRE)--March 27, 2001--

The First Utility Company to Wire Its Workforce, Cinergy Will Make PeoplePC's Complete Personal Computing Solution Available to 7,500 Employees

PeoplePC (Nasdaq:PEOP), the company that makes it easy and affordable to get online, today announced a partnership with Cinergy Corp., one of the nation's leading diversified energy companies, to offer its 7,500 U.S. employees a home computer with Internet access.

The first utility company to invest in an employee connectivity program, Cinergy will subsidize the program so that employees pay a $7.00 monthly co-pay over a three-year term for PeoplePC's basic offer. The basic bundle includes one of Hewlett-Packard's latest desktop models, unlimited Internet access, 24/7 customer support, a three-year warranty, and membership in a unique online community. As with PeoplePC's other employee connectivity programs, employees will have the option to purchase higher-end desktops and laptops. In the case of employees who already own PCs, Cinergy will subsidize the cost of PeoplePC's ISP service for three years. Planning for the program has begun, and the rollout will commence in June.

Through this program, Cinergy employees will soon have access to a host of progressive HR services, including the ability to update benefits and manage their 401K accounts online. In addition, employees will eventually be able to access their work email from home.

PeoplePC pioneered the employee connectivity program and is already offering its complete computing solution to the employees of Vivendi Universal Group (NYSE:V), Ford Motor Company and Ford/Lincoln dealerships (NYSE:F), Delta Air Lines (NYSE:DAL), the New York Times Company (NYSE:NYT), and members of the unions affiliated with the National Trade Union Congress of Singapore. About Cinergy

Cinergy Corp., one of the nation's leading diversified energy companies, has a focused strategy intent on growing its energy merchant business. The company owns, operates or has under development over 21,000 megawatts of generation. Cinergy has the 6th largest electricity trading organization in the U.S. as well as physical and financial gas trading capabilities of 17 bcf/day. The "Into Cinergy" power trading hub is the most liquid trading hub in the United States. Cinergy's energy merchant business operates in several regions of the U.S. and is based on a profitable balance of asset development, customer origination, marketing and trading, industrial-site cogeneration infrastructure development and plant operations.

Cinergy also owns regulated operations in Ohio, Indiana and Kentucky that serve about 1.5 million electric customers and about 500,000 gas customers. In addition, Cinergy manages one of the industry's top power technology portfolios.
